The Supply Chain Manager will be responsible for ensuring parts are delivered on time whilst interacting with the wider business on engineering, production and planning. They will have proven managerial and supply chain experience with a bachelor’s degree, preferably in a related discipline. They must have outstanding communication, excellent attention to detail, be IT literate, and have excellent time management.
Job responsibilities:
· Generate weekly stock usage reports and engage with monthly reporting activities
· Use of supply chain tools and systems including Sage and Zoho.
· Communicating and relationship building/maintenance with vendors (including
overseas)
· Locating new suppliers.
· Assisting R&D in ordering and bringing new products into stock.
· Managing new product introductions at the system level.
· Process shipping documents and delivery notes.
· Arranging sea shipments with chosen logistics suppliers.
· Booking on stock, processing amendments to records, order processing and
creating purchase orders.
· Communication with other departments including on stock arrival schedules and
new product introductions.
· Assemble monthly accrual calculations of freight and warehousing expenditure.
· Maintaining in-house spreadsheets and other records accurately.
· Coordinate with support functions to resolve any open accounts or stock related
issues
· Produce stock usage, credit or progress reports when required.
· Regular reconciliation of system stock vs. warehouse stock.
· Maintain and develop relationships with third party companies.
· Product sourcing, data analysis and reporting on trends.
